Transaction f754b47ebcad749cdcad5ed3a55a50db486c2053bf3b4c72eb65b3af40c4787f
2 Input
1 Outputs
- f754b47ebcad749cdcad5ed3a55a50db486c2053bf3b4c72eb65b3af40c4787f:0
value 3931798
address 3PTbbCheXzTb4zXxZ8zyQfUd5UNi2KPbpu